CI NOTE — Quillport PDF Invoice Renderer

Support team: if customers report blank invoice pages, check whether the render job ran on the patched pipeline. The older toolchain embedded a broken glyph table, producing PDFs that open but show empty line items. The fix landed in the Ashgrove branch and is fully rolled out; any job after the cutover is safe. When escalating, always quote the renderer build so engineering can confirm. The corrected build is:

trace token, kawip-fafog: htk14_26e64c4d35154e

Subject: DR drill — Gatewright breaker

Drill runs Tuesday 0900. We will force-fail the upstream Nimbuscore API and verify the Gatewright circuit breaker opens within ten seconds, sheds load, and half-opens on schedule. No code freeze needed; config only. Release manager verifies dashboards and signs off. To flip the breaker override in the drill console, authenticate with the recovery passphrase below.

unlock words, yagep-fahof: belix-rusvan-casdor-gorox-aldath-norael-istix-quenael-fraeth-silael

### Changed: DRIFT_COMP_WINDOW renamed

Heads up for the sync — the old `SENSOR_SMOOTH` setting on the Fernhaus greenhouse controller is now `DRIFT_COMP_WINDOW`, since it only ever compensated humidity drift anyway. Old name still works until v4. While you're editing the controller env file, also re-add the telemetry signing credential, which goes right after this note.

vault entry, bagaf-fahog: ARCHIVE_KEY3=71e

Ticket: Staging env misconfigured for Siftgate bloom filter

The bloom layer in front of the Pellet KV store is rejecting all lookups in staging because the env file was copied from the dev template without credentials. False-positive tuning values are fine; only the auth line is missing. To unblock the weekly demo, the Pellet admission secret must be set on the following line.

env line for yaguf-fajop: LEDGER_TOKEN13=fb08984397349